自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

郑泽林

Learning sea without boundaries

  • 博客(119)
  • 收藏
  • 关注

原创 使用 for循环嵌套 或 while 循环嵌套 来打印 九九乘法表 !

文章目录目的:使用 for 循环嵌套:使用 while 循环实现:         此链接通往 Bash Shell 编程学习的目录导航 ,从入门到放弃,感兴趣的可以去看看:目的:实现 打印 99乘法表:1*1=1 1*2=2 2*2=4 1*3=3 2*3=6 3*3=9 1*4=4 2*4=8 3*4=12...

2020-04-03 21:51:38 4785

原创 一文教你如何使用 for循环嵌套 ! 并且打印 各种三角形 与 菱形 !

文章目录1、嵌套的 for 循环 打印三角形!1.1、使用for嵌套循环 打印正三角形!  解释:1.2、使用for嵌套循环 打印倒三角形!1.3、使用 for循环嵌套 打印等腰正三角:2、使用 for 循环嵌套打印菱形:2.1、先输出一个正的等腰三角形:2.2、输出 倒等腰三角形2.3、将 两个三角形 合并成一个 菱形:       &nb...

2020-04-02 23:03:05 6685 2

原创 一文让你通俗易懂的学习会 Bash Shell 中的 for 循环语句(for 的两种语法结构 和 嵌套for循环)

文章目录★ 语法格式分为两类:1、语法格式 1 的介绍:1.1、语法格式 1 的工作原理:1.2、语法格式 1 的取值列表:①、字符串:②、范围集合:③、文件名:④、命令执行结果:⑤、位置变量 及 系统变量:2、语法格式 2 的介绍:2.1、语法格式 2 的工作原理:2.2、语法格式 2 (( )) 的几个常用用法:①、打印 1 - 100 之间所有的数:②、打印 1 - 100 之间所有奇偶数...

2020-04-02 22:00:32 980

原创 一文教你学会 for循环 的嵌套模式:

文章目录1、for 循环 语法格式:2、for循环嵌套的执行过程:3、利用for基础打印一个矩形:4、使用 for循环嵌套 打印矩形:解释:         此链接通往 Bash Shell 编程学习的目录导航 ,从入门到放弃,感兴趣的可以去看看:1、for 循环 语法格式:两个 for 循环的语法格式:#!/bin/bashfo...

2020-04-02 21:59:46 4455

原创 Bash Shell 中的 case 选择语句:

文章目录1、case 语句介绍:2、case 语法格式:3、case 使用例子:         此链接通往 Bash Shell 编程学习的目录导航 ,从入门到放弃,感兴趣的可以去看看:1、case 语句介绍:               case 选择...

2020-03-31 15:59:01 996

原创 Shell 中的 if 流程判断语句:

文章目录1、if 语句的格式:2、综合实例:         此链接通往 Bash Shell 编程学习的目录导航 ,从入门到放弃,感兴趣的可以去看看:1、if 语句的格式:if 语句很简单,就是满足条件,则执行... 反正则执行..."单条件:"if [ 条件表达式 ];then 语句1...fi————————...

2020-03-30 20:15:53 540

原创 Linux 内部命令 read 详解!默认读取来自键盘的输入,可以使用 -u 指定来自 fd 的输入!

文章目录1、格式:2、举例:2.1、read -p 指定提示信息:2.2、reap -a 数组参数:2.3、read -d 指定定界符:2.4、read -n 指定变量值的参数个数:2.5、read -t 指定赋值的时间:2.6、read -s 指定为安静模式:3、未指定 varname 怎么办??? read —— 内部命令!root@zhengzelin:~# type re...

2020-03-30 18:18:20 1989

原创 在使用变量的时候,双引号和单引号 如何使用,及其区别:

文章目录         此链接通往 Bash Shell 编程学习的目录导航 ,从入门到放弃,感兴趣的可以去看看:当你再给变量赋值的时候,值是一串字符串,并且中间有空格,该如何赋值?使用单双引号:(都可以)root@zhengzelin:~# a="aaa bbb ccc";echo $aaaa bbb cccroot@zh...

2020-03-30 15:49:07 3078

原创 详解:Bash Shell 脚本中的括号:()、(( ))、[ ]、[[ ]]、{ } 及 他们使用的运算符!

         此链接通往 Bash Shell 编程学习的目录导航 ,从入门到放弃,感兴趣的可以去看看:

2020-03-30 15:07:04 1760

原创 Bash Shell 中的 test —— 条件测试!以及 test 和 [ ] :

文章目录test 命令的作用:help test 查看更多信息:1、test 中的 文件测试运算符2、test 中的 字符串运算符:3、test 中的 其他运算符:eg:①:使用 test 来测试字符串:eg:②:使用 test 进行算数测试:★ 与 test 完全等价的符号: [ ]:         此链接通往 Bash Shell 编程...

2020-03-29 18:01:22 872

原创 Bash Shell 脚本中使用 位置变量时候:提醒用户输入 位置变量的参数 以及位置变量参数的类型!

         此链接通往 Bash Shell 编程学习的目录导航 ,从入门到放弃,感兴趣的可以去看看: 当你在脚本中写入位置变量的时候,如果忘记在执行脚本后面跟上 参数的时候,会报错又麻烦,那么如何让脚本提醒用户添加位置变量的参数呢??root@zhengzelin:~# vim test.sh [ $# -ne...

2020-03-28 23:13:12 782

原创 Bash Shell 中 特殊的 字符串测试符号: =~

         此链接通往 Bash Shell 编程学习的目录导航 ,从入门到放弃,感兴趣的可以去看看: 关于 字符串测试运算符,咱们都知道有 : -a 、-n、 =、!=、> 、< 。-a : # 判断是否为空字符串,是空则为 true。-n : # 判断是否为非空字符串,非空则为 true。= :#...

2020-03-28 20:23:25 1299

原创 Bash Shell 中的 算术运算符、逻辑与或非(& | !)运算符、整数关系运算符、字符串关系运算符、文件或目录测试运算符

文章目录1、算术运算符:①、使用 let 实现算术运算:②、使用 expr 实现算术运算:③、使用 [ ] 实现算术运算:④、使用 (( )) 实现算术运算:2、关系运算符:①、[ ] 中 使用 > 的例子:②、[[ ]] 中 使用 > 的例子:③、(( )) 中使用 > 的例子:3、逻辑运算符:①、 [ ] 中使用 -a :②、[[ ]] 中使用 &&:③、(...

2020-03-27 21:35:40 5390

原创 你知道什么是 短路与 和 短路非吗 ???

先来说一下 与运算 和 或运算: & 和 |:& 与 (双方都成立 ,结果才为 true )0 —— flaes; 1——true0 & 0 —— 00 & 1 —— 01 & 0 —— 01 & 1 —— 1| 或 (或者的意思,两边有一个结果为 true ,答案即为 true)0 | 0 —— 00 | 1...

2020-03-27 21:31:07 1310 1

原创 如何 打印随机颜色的字体? Bash 中的 $RANDOM ——随机数生成器 如何使用?

随机数生成器 —— $RANDOM:Bash Shell 中有内建的随机数生成器: $RANDOM root@zhengzelin:~$ echo $RANDOM 生成值得默认范围是 0-3276713147如果你要指定随机数生成的范围的话:root@zhengzelin:~$ echo $[RANDOM%50]输出值得范围是:0-49 ************...

2020-03-27 18:35:02 540

原创 你知道什么是 块设备 和 字符设备 吗?以及如何查看 块设备文件 和 字符设备文件 ?

关于块设备 和 字符设备 介绍:               系统中能够随机(不需要按顺序)访问固定大小数据片(chunks)的设备被称作块设备,这些数据片就称作块。        最常见的块设备是硬盘,除此以外,还有软盘驱动器、CD-ROM驱动器和闪存等等许多其他块设备。...

2020-03-27 17:55:14 3703

原创 常见的正则表达式使用例子:

文章目录1、显示 /proc/meminfo 文件中以 大小s 开头的行:2、显示 /etc/passwd 中不以 /bin/bash 结尾的行3、显示用户 ntp 默认的shell程序4、显示出 /etc/passwd 中的十位数或百位数:5、显示某文件中 以空格开头却不是空行的行:6、"netstat -tan" 命令的结果中以 LISTEN后跟任意空白字符结尾的行7、过滤出 "/etc/ss...

2020-03-25 21:50:12 1365

原创 正则表达式

文章目录通配符?正则表达式?哪些程序支持 正则表达式!正则表达式引擎:基础正则表达式:①、字符匹配:②、匹配次数:③、位置:④、分组 和 或者 :4.1、分组 \\(\\) 的使用例子:4.2、\1 、 \2 .. 的使用例子:4.3、或者 "\\|" 的使用例子:扩展正则表达式:①、字符匹配:grep -v 与 [^] 的区别:②、匹配次数:③ 位置:④、分组 和 或者: &nb...

2020-03-25 21:46:44 242

原创 Shell 脚本的工作原理:

        此链接通往 Shell 编程学习的目录导航 ,从入门到放弃,感兴趣的可以去看看:  本章学习一下 shell脚本 的工作原理!当我们写了一个shell脚本之后,执行的时候,并不是在当前 shell 下执行,而是打开一个子shell 来执行该脚本!证明如下:root@zhengzelin:~# vim test...

2020-03-24 19:03:55 631

原创 Shell 编程 入门篇(打好基础篇):

文章目录1、Shell 编程的脚本格式:2、分享一个自动给脚本添加注释的文件:3、使用 bash -n 命令查看脚本语法问题:4、使用 bash -x 查看脚本输出内容:        此链接通往 Shell 编程学习的目录导航 ,从入门到放弃,感兴趣的可以去看看:  1、Shell 编程的脚本格式:1: 脚本名字格式: ...

2020-03-24 18:23:41 377

原创 和 SHELL 解释器 有关的一些命令

文章目录1、查看当前系统所支持的 Shell :2、查看 当前 Shell 类型:3、关于 shell 的 子shell:4、查看某个用户的 Shell 类型:5、"pstree -p" 树状结构显示 Shell进程关系:6、login shell :7、        此链接通往 Shell 编程的目录导航 ,从入门到放弃,感兴趣的可以去看看:&nb...

2020-03-24 15:13:23 237

原创 关于 Shell 解释器 介绍!

文章目录1、Shell 解释器简介:2、Linux shell种类:  ①、bourne again shell(/bin/bash) —— 最常用  ②、bourne shell(/use/bin/sh 或 /bin/sh)  ③、C shell (/usr/bin/csh)  ④、K shell (/usr/bin/ksh)   ...

2020-03-24 11:36:13 1866

原创 Shell 及 Shell编程 目录导航

本章作为一个目录导航,可以方便的去往有关shell的每个文章!

2020-03-24 10:36:49 1029

原创 跟 Linux登录系统无关的环境变量学习

文章目录Centos: ~/.bash_logout(注销时生效)Centos / Ubuntu: ~/.bash_history(记录上次退出登录之前所敲历史命令)Centos / Ubuntu:/etc/issue(本地终端欢迎(警告)信息)Centos / Ubuntu:/etc/issue.net(远程终端欢迎(警告)信息)Centos / Ubuntu:/etc/motd (远程或本地终...

2020-03-23 18:36:15 305

原创 Centos 中没有 /etc/sysconfig/i18n 如何永久修改当前系统语言!

文章目录i18n 这个文件的作用?查看当前系统所使用的语言类型:查看当前系统所支持的所有语言类型临时修改 语言类型:步入正题,永久修改语言类型:  i18n 这个文件的作用?       这个文件就是定义了系统当前所用的语言类型!其实这个文件并不是所有的计算机上都有,所以说使用这个路径并不是很严谨! 查看当前系统所...

2020-03-23 16:26:43 7695

原创 深入浅出的学习变量(局部、全局、系统、位置、只读变量... set 命令、export 命令、以及如何设置环境变量!)

文章目录变量?变量的赋值:①、静态语言 或 强类型②、动态语言 或 弱类型变量名命名规则? ==bash 中 变量的种类:==①、局部变量:★ 如何使用局部变量?★ 如何证明局部变量的生效范围?①、首先 使用 set 命令查看所有变量:②、接着 使用 bash 命令 进入当前shell 的子shell 进程:③、然后 使用 pstree -p 来查看进程之间的树状关系图:④、最后 使用...

2020-03-22 11:17:31 926

原创 通俗易懂的学习 Linux 登录系统时如何加载环境变量?(有图更方便理解)

文章目录 这里是自己写的一个 shell入门到放弃 的一个目录导航!因为本章是学习shell 接触的变量,所以这里的例子都是在 shell 中使用 变量。戳我去学习变量:简单易懂,从0开始,各种知识点都会提及到  ...

2020-03-22 11:09:03 1900

原创 awk 使用多个分隔符以及 打印奇偶行

文章目录☆☆☆   AWK 高级用法:1、多个分隔符 以及 连续相同的分隔符、字符串分隔符:2、awk 中 打印奇偶行: 这个是我自己写的 全部关于 awk学习的目录导航 ,感兴趣的可以看看。 ☆☆☆   AWK 高级用法: 1、多个分隔符 以及 连续相同的分隔符、字符串分隔符:当需要指定 多个分隔符的时候,怎么做?当你不小...

2020-03-12 17:22:37 2266 1

原创 awk 中使用 三元运算 : 条件?"结果1":"结果2"

文章目录 这个是我自己写的 全部关于 awk学习的目录导航 ,感兴趣的可以看看。 记得我在 学习 awk 中 使用 “if…else…” 的时候:root@zhengzelin:~# awk 'BEGIN{FS=":"} {if($3<500) {printf "%-20s\t%-10s\n",$1,"系统用户"} else{printf "%-20s\t%-...

2020-03-12 12:52:58 777

原创 awk 中的 内置函数:

文章目录字符串函数:gsub(r,s) —— 将范围内所有r 替换为 ssub(r,s) —— 将范围内第一个r换为slength(s) —— 获取s的长度index(a,b) —— 返回a中b的位置:split 函数 ——切割字符串其他函数asort函数 —— 根据元素值顺序排序asort函数的返回值 这个是我自己写的 全部关于 awk学习的目录导航 ,感兴趣的可以看看。&nbs...

2020-03-12 12:00:54 596

原创 使用 awk for循环 和 数组 实现 去重功能:(sort 、uniq、tr 功能)

文章目录 这个是我自己写的 全部关于 awk学习的目录导航 ,感兴趣的可以看看。          本章直接使用 awk 中的for循环 和 数组 实现 去重 and 统计 功能!       在学习之前,先来看一个知识点:首先,我们将 变量a的值设为1,进行加法计算...

2020-03-11 10:20:58 1860

原创 awk 中的循环语句(for 、 while)及跳出循环:continue、break;exit,next!

文章目录for 的语法格式:while 的语法格式: 这个是我自己写的 全部关于 awk学习的目录导航 ,感兴趣的可以看看。          在上一文章,我学习了 如何在 awk 中使用 if 条件判断句,这一章 我打算学习一下 awk 中的 循环语句!,一说到循环,肯定就想到了 for、while 等…&nb...

2020-03-09 22:24:16 13387

原创 通俗易懂理解什么是数组?awk 中使用数组 以及 for循环!!!

文章目录什么是数组?数组中的四种基本数据结构:1、集合:2、线性结构(一对一):3、树形结构(一对多):4、图状结构(多对多):为什么要用数组?一维数组:一维数组的语法格式:awk 中声明数组:数组的元素设置:delete —— 删除数组元素:使用 for 循环:数字下标 与 字符串下标 这个是我自己写的 全部关于 awk学习的目录导航 ,感兴趣的可以看看。 &nbs...

2020-03-09 22:10:06 1839 2

原创 关于awk 中如何使用 if条件判断句

文章目录 这个是我自己写的 全部关于 awk学习的目录导航 ,感兴趣的可以看看。         首先,大家都知道 if 条件判断句 吧,这个就算不知道 也很好理解吧:无非就是条件成立则执行对应的代码、条件不成立则不执行!       在 awk 中,我们也是可以搭配 ...

2020-03-08 18:39:20 28285

转载 awk 中 next 语句使用:

文章目录 这个是我自己写的 全部关于 awk学习的目录导航 ,感兴趣的可以看看。         next :它告诉 awk ,跳过你所提供的所有剩下的模式和表达式!直接处理下一个输入行!直接举一个例子:运行下面的命令,它将在每个食物数量小于或者等于 20 的行后面标一个星号:上面的命令实际运行如下:1、...

2020-03-07 18:21:47 857

原创 awk 格式化(使用 printf 动作):

文章目录 这个是我自己写的 全部关于 awk学习的目录导航 ,感兴趣的可以看看。         在 上文 说到过 printf命令 是没法自动换行的。当然,在 awk 中的 printf 动作 也是如此:       要想让 awk中的 printf动作 换行,当然可以使...

2020-03-07 09:41:12 1362

原创 关于 print 和 printf:

 这个是我自己写的 全部关于 awk学习的目录导航 ,感兴趣的可以看看。 关于 print               print 我们都知道,它是 awk 中最常用的动作,根据 awk 的匹配规则,匹配到需要的数据,然后使用 print 打印出来!    ...

2020-03-04 20:27:37 3609

原创 AWK 基础篇(常用参数、打印单双引号、逗号和分号、常用的操作符、运算符、判断符;内置变量)

文章目录1、awk 简介:2、awk 语法格式:2.1、常用 Option :2.2、脚本命令 :3、awk 的匹配规则(pattern):4、awk 脚本的基本结构:4.1、举例使用 BEGIN 和 END 语句块:5、awk 的工作原理:6、awk 中的变量:6.1、内建变量:☆☆☆   AWK 高级用法: 1、awk 简介: ①、awk 是一种编程语言...

2020-03-03 11:55:33 6121

原创 AWK 从入门 ———>放弃

这个目录被我用来做一个导航,这里的文章都是关于 awk 的:

2020-03-03 11:49:49 1098 1

原创 API 的基础知识:

文章目录API 的格式:YAML 格式:API - Lable       这里是我自己写的一个 “小白学习 kubernetes” 的一个目录导航!跟我一样的小白可以跟着导航一起进行学习: kubernetes 学习导航:  API 的格式:kubernetes 的 API 是由:HTTP + json/...

2019-12-28 18:15:37 311

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除